How do I find federal contracting opportunities?

Federal contracting opportunities are posted on SAM.gov (System for Award Management). You can search by keyword, NAICS code, set-aside type, agency, and response deadline. FedOps aggregates and enriches SAM.gov data daily so you can filter and track opportunities in one place.

What is a set-aside in federal contracting?

A set-aside is a procurement reserved for a specific category of small business. Common set-asides include SDVOSB (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ned), 8(a), WOSB (Women-Owned), HUBZone, and Small Business. Only businesses that meet the eligibility requirements can bid on a set-aside contract.

How do I register to bid on federal contracts?

You must register your business in SAM.gov (sam.gov), which is free. You'll need a DUNS/UEI number, NAICS codes for your business, bank account information for electronic funds transfer, and applicable certifications (8(a), SDVOSB, WOSB, etc.) if bidding on set-asides. Registration is renewed annually.
